Pittsburgh: Edgeworth Club, 1993. Book. As New. Cloth. First Edition. Quarto, forest green cloth covered boards with gilt title and spine titles. 225 pp. including appendix listing officers and stewards of the club by year throughout its history. Illustrated throughout with black and white historical photographs, illustrations, reproductions, maps, plans etc. Full page color frontispiece portrait of "Mr. Edgeworth". Errata slip laid in. A very tight, clean, unblemished volume with very fresh cloth, sparkling gilt and bright white interior. Unmarked and apparently unread. Without dust jacket as issued. Fine. Pristine. AS NEW..
